duanpo2813 2010-09-07 23:28
浏览 39
已采纳

在我的所有页面中都可以看到相同的cookie

I created 2 separate page that uses cookies for auto login. But if I login both of them and if i refresh one of the page , I can see that site recognize the other cookie. Like if I print in both site user name to screen , after refresh I see the same user name in both site. I am running 2 sites in my localhost. And I did not specify location for cookie.

  • 写回答

1条回答 默认 最新

  • dongxun3777 2010-09-07 23:46
    关注

    I guess you're using the same key for both pages.

    Cookies are stored by browsers per server or domain. For different paths, cookies with same names can have different values.

    In your case, if you're using the same key for both login pages then in every request to your local web server, the value of that cookie will be the one which was last set by one of the pages if you omit path and domain when cookie is created.

    You can use different names for the cookies to solve your problem or different paths for your cookies.

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

悬赏问题

  • ¥15 Revit2020下载问题
  • ¥15 使用EMD去噪处理RML2016数据集时候的原理
  • ¥15 神经网络预测均方误差很小 但是图像上看着差别太大
  • ¥15 Oracle中如何从clob类型截取特定字符串后面的字符
  • ¥15 想通过pywinauto自动电机应用程序按钮,但是找不到应用程序按钮信息
  • ¥15 如何在炒股软件中,爬到我想看的日k线
  • ¥15 seatunnel 怎么配置Elasticsearch
  • ¥15 PSCAD安装问题 ERROR: Visual Studio 2013, 2015, 2017 or 2019 is not found in the system.
  • ¥15 (标签-MATLAB|关键词-多址)
  • ¥15 关于#MATLAB#的问题,如何解决?(相关搜索:信噪比,系统容量)